However the company has never used the word patent or Intellectual property or patent pending....only proprietary. This should alarm share holders as it there is a huge difference in what this means for AC8 and most importantly it share holders... Intellectual Property is protected by law. These are trademarks, copyrights, and patents. It's illegal for anyone besides the rights holder to use them in certain ways, mainly for business purposes. Proprietary information is secret info that a business uses to gain an edge, but it's not protected by law. It's protected by secrecy instead, enforced by non-disclosure agreements that is part of an employee's contract.
